Baucus Proposes Funding Assistance for Families of Space Shuttle Columbia Heroes

News Release: In honor of the men and women who lost their lives on Feb. 1, 2003 aboard the space shuttle Columbia, Senator Max Baucus today introduced legislation that would provide assistance to the astronauts’ family members.
